蓝桥杯 ADV-78 算法提高 最长单词
2017-03-06 13:31
316 查看
编写一个函数,输入一行字符,将此字符串中最长的单词输出。
输入仅一行,多个单词,每个单词间用一个空格隔开。单词仅由小写字母组成。所有单词的长度和不超过100000。如有多个最长单词,输出最先出现的。
样例输入
I am a student
样例输出
student
输入仅一行,多个单词,每个单词间用一个空格隔开。单词仅由小写字母组成。所有单词的长度和不超过100000。如有多个最长单词,输出最先出现的。
样例输入
I am a student
样例输出
student
#include <iostream> using namespace std; int main() { string s; string temp; int mmax = 0; while(cin >> temp) { int len = temp.length(); if(mmax < len) { mmax = len; s = temp; } } cout << s; return 0; }
相关文章推荐
- 蓝桥杯 ADV-78 算法提高 最长单词
- 蓝桥杯 ADV-78 算法提高 最长单词
- 算法提高 ADV-78 最长单词
- ADV-78-算法提高-最长单词
- 【ShawnZhang】带你看蓝桥杯——算法提高 最长单词
- 蓝桥杯 ADV-102 算法提高 单词个数统计
- 蓝桥杯 算法提高VIP 最长单词(Java解题)
- 蓝桥杯 ADV-102 算法提高 单词个数统计
- 蓝桥杯 ADV-105 算法提高 不同单词个数统计
- 蓝桥杯ADV-17算法提高 统计单词数
- 蓝桥杯练习系统试题集 算法提高 ADV-147 学霸的迷宫
- 算法提高 最长单词
- 蓝桥杯 ADV-171 算法提高 身份证号码升级
- 蓝桥杯 ADV-88 算法提高 输出正反三角形
- 蓝桥杯 ADV-90 算法提高 输出日历
- 蓝桥杯 ADV-119 算法提高 6-9删除数组中的0元素
- 蓝桥杯 ADV-209 算法提高 c++_ch02_04
- 蓝桥杯 ADV-155 算法提高 上帝造题五分钟
- 蓝桥杯 ADV-143算法提高 扶老奶奶过街
- 蓝桥杯 ADV-156算法提高 分分钟的碎碎念(动态规划)